Overview Of The Cyber Security Analyst Job
A cyber security analyst protects organizations from cyber threats by analyzing and responding to security incidents. This role is crucial in safeguarding sensitive information and maintaining the integrity of IT systems.
Key Responsibilities
Cyber security analysts monitor network security and conduct vulnerability assessments. They analyze security breaches and develop response strategies. Creating and updating security policies plays a vital role in their daily activities. They also educate staff on security protocols to minimize human error. Additionally, collaborating with IT teams to enhance security measures is essential. Analysts must report security incidents and document their findings clearly.
Required Skills
Analytical thinking is crucial for identifying patterns in security threats. Attention to detail helps in recognizing vulnerabilities in systems. Proficiency in various security tools and technologies is necessary to conduct assessments effectively. Communication skills enable analysts to explain security risks to non-technical stakeholders. Problem-solving abilities assist in developing strategies to counteract threats. Finally, knowledge of compliance regulations ensures organizations adhere to security standards.
Educational Requirements

Becoming a cyber security analyst necessitates a solid educational foundation. Two key components of this foundation are degree programs and certifications.
Degree Programs
Bachelor’s degrees in cyber security or related fields, like information technology, play an essential role in developing foundational knowledge. Various institutions also offer programs specifically designed to build skills tailored for this field. Relevant coursework often includes network security, systems administration, and risk management. Some employers prefer candidates with advanced degrees, such as a Master’s in cyber security or computer science. These advanced programs can provide deeper insights into complex security concepts, enhancing career prospects.
Certifications
Certifications strengthen a candidate’s qualifications and demonstrate expertise to potential employers. Obtaining certifications like CompTIA Security+, Certified Information Systems Security Professional (CISSP), or Certified Ethical Hacker (CEH) showcases commitment to the field. Many organizations value these credentials, as they indicate proficiency in important areas like risk assessment and security protocols. Some professionals pursue specialized certifications in areas such as cloud security or penetration testing for further skill enhancement.
Job Market Outlook
The job market for cyber security analysts shows strong growth, reflecting increased demand for protection against cyber threats. Organizations across various sectors recognize the necessity of skilled professionals in this field.
Employment Opportunities
Employment opportunities are abundant for cyber security analysts. According to the U.S. Bureau of Labor Statistics, employment in this field is projected to grow by 33% from 2020 to 2030, significantly faster than the average for all occupations. Businesses, government agencies, and healthcare organizations actively seek these professionals to safeguard sensitive information. Job roles vary widely, ranging from entry-level positions focused on monitoring security systems to advanced roles that involve developing complex security strategies. Networking with industry professionals and joining relevant security groups often leads to valuable job leads and career advancement.
Salary Expectations
Salary expectations for cyber security analysts are competitive. According to the U.S. Bureau of Labor Statistics, the median annual wage for these professionals was approximately $103,590 in May 2020. Factors influencing salary include experience, certifications, and geographic location. Analysts working in major metropolitan areas often command higher salaries due to increased demand and cost of living. Additionally, specialized skills in areas such as cloud security can lead to even higher earnings. Overall, pursuing a career in cyber security presents lucrative financial opportunities.
Essential Tools And Technologies
Cyber security analysts rely on a variety of tools and technologies to perform their duties effectively. These resources help protect sensitive information from threats while ensuring robust security measures.
Security Software
Analysts frequently use firewalls to monitor incoming and outgoing traffic. Intrusion Detection Systems (IDS) serve to identify potential threats in real-time. Antivirus software is essential for detecting and removing malicious software, while encryption tools protect sensitive data from unauthorized access. Additionally, Security Information and Event Management (SIEM) systems aggregate security alerts from multiple sources, allowing for comprehensive monitoring. Utilizing threat intelligence platforms keeps analysts updated on the latest security vulnerabilities and attack vectors.
Analytical Tools
Data analysis is crucial for understanding security events. Analysts use tools like Splunk for analyzing machine-generated data, turning it into actionable insights. Log management solutions help track user activities and potential breaches. Vulnerability assessment tools enable identification of weaknesses in a network or system. Penetration testing software allows analysts to simulate attacks, testing defenses prior to actual incidents. Decision-making processes are enhanced through visualization tools, providing graphical representations of complex data to identify trends and patterns in security incidents.
